Postmortem examinations of brain tissue taken from people with essential tremor reveal various abnormalities in the cerebellum and brainstem, including the loss of Purkinje cells, which produce an important neurotransmitter, called GABA. The tremors typically worsen when the hands are being used (kinetic or intention tremor), and reduce significantly or stop altogether when the hands are resting. An updated consensus statement in 2018 redefined essential tremor as an isolated action tremor present in bilateral upper extremities for at least three years. Essential tremor also appears to involve a disruption in the activity of motor pathways, but its uncertain whether there is any loss of brain cells. While currently available Parkinsons treatments cannot slow or halt the disease, they can help manage symptoms. Parkinsons disease is marked by a progressive loss of brain cells that produce dopamine, a chemical messenger that enables normal body movements.
